Forecasting blooming date based on developmental rate of the ecodormancy stage in 'Kawazu-zakura' (Prunus lannesiana Wils. 'Kawazu-zakura') cherry trees

description | The developmental index (DVI) was calculated based on the developmental rate (DVR) of endodormancy in Kawazu-zakura (Prunus lannesiana Wils. 'Kawazu-zakura') cherry trees. We developed to forecast the blooming period model based on the calculated DVI. The blooming date and fallen blossom date could be forecast according to the model considering the expected temperatures. The define error for the blooming dates is about 4 days, and then the forecasting of the flower bud stage is when the green seems to begin to crack. The error becomes smaller as the forecast advances with the growth of the floral bud. The treatment of the developed model in this study was easy. Therefore, it was expected to be useful to promote sightseeing. |
